I had wanted to own an MG ZR since the age of 17. I just love the look of them and to me they don’t seem to have aged. I remember there being a silver Mk2 ZR for sale in 2012 which I was going to buy but I ended up owning a 1982 classic Austin Mini for four years instead.
The Mini needed a lot of repairs and, with money tight, I ended up stripping my Mini down and selling the bits off for parts. The money bought me my ZR in January 2015.
